Claude Fable 5 vs. Kimi K3: Same results, one-third the cost, 4x slower
A benchmarking test between Claude Fable 5 and Kimi K3 shows similar results, but at a significantly lower cost and with a fourfold increase in processing time.
Intelligence analysis by Llama
The benchmarking test between Claude Fable 5 and Kimi K3 reveals that both models produce similar results, but at a cost that is one-third of the Kimi K3's original price. However, the processing time for the Claude Fable 5 is four times slower than the Kimi K3.
